What is Driver CPC (Periodic) Training?

Driver CPC (Periodic) Training is the ongoing professional development requirement for HGV and bus drivers. Every qualified professional driver must complete 35 hours of approved periodic training every 5 years to maintain their Driver Qualification Card (DQC) β€” without which they cannot legally drive commercially.

The 35 hours are typically completed as individual one-day (7-hour) training sessions, spread across the 5-year cycle at times that suit you and your employer.

Why Keep Your DQC Up to Date?

  • βœ“ Legal requirement β€” driving commercially without a valid DQC is an offence
  • βœ“ DVSA enforcement β€” roadside checks include DQC verification
  • βœ“ Employment requirement β€” no compliant employer will allow an expired DQC
  • βœ“ Keeps skills current β€” covers key topics like road safety, tachograph rules and health

How Hours Are Recorded

Completed training hours are uploaded directly to the DVSA database and will appear on your driver record. Your updated DQC will be issued by DVLA automatically when you've completed the full 35 hours before your current card's expiry date.
